U1A MUTANT/RNA COMPLEX + GLYCEROL
Overview
The crystal structure of the RNA-binding domain of the small nuclear, ribonucleoprotein U1A bound to a 21-nucleotide RNA hairpin has been, determined at 1.92 A resolution. The ten-nucleotide RNA loop binds to the, surface of the beta-sheet as an open structure, and the AUUGCAC sequence, of the loop interacts extensively with the conserved RNP1 and RNP2 motifs, and the C-terminal extension of the RNP domain. These interactions include, stacking of RNA bases with aromatic side chains of proteins and many, direct and water-mediated hydrogen bonds. The structure reveals the, stereochemical basis for sequence-specific RNA recognition by the RNP, domain.

Reference
Crystal structure at 1.92 A resolution of the RNA-binding domain of the U1A spliceosomal protein complexed with an RNA hairpin., Oubridge C, Ito N, Evans PR, Teo CH, Nagai K, Nature. 1994 Dec 1;372(6505):432-8. PMID:7984237
